Perfect Square
10237981753539962109007083938925410157561900769 is a perfect square (101182912359449123088113 × 101182912359449123088113)
10237981753539962109007083938925410157561900769 is a perfect square (101182912359449123088113 × 101182912359449123088113)
10237981753539962109007083938925410157561900769 is odd
Previous odd number is 10237981753539962109007083938925410157561900767
Next odd number is 10237981753539962109007083938925410157561900771
111001011000101100100010001001001101010110100011010000100101101001010000101100111001110000111100001011101000101000101110111010010010010111110111011100001
1073107063684107551881425344220286732068146176141439420387457348778028951095462841028601780961043001741384450140757545226716582158692456609
104816270385817197447943403708078809240523623588962327529773785074138238651033153940202791361